The cloud has become part of our lives. We store everything there from our photos, phone back-ups and even boarding passes. There is a huge difference between what you get for free and what you get when you pay. Dropbox provides only 2GB of storage for free and Apple 5GB, while New Zealand-based mega.nz provides 50GB for free. However, with a Microsoft Office365 subscripti­on for €69 per year you get a terabyte of storage. That’s more than most of us will ever need. The real value in this deal is that you also get full versions of Microsoft applicatio­ns such as Word and Excel, including the brilliant iOS and Android apps. There’s a home mode that switches on the kettle using the location of your phone and you can add extra users to the kettle as everyone probably likes a cuppa when they come in.

The formula mode is ideal for new parents and will heat the kettle and alert you when it’s at the ideal temperatur­e for making baby formula.

The reason I waited and bought the third version of this kettle, though, is the smart-home integratio­n.

The iKettle is now compatible with Nest and Amazon’s Echo. After connecting the kettle to my Amazon account, I can now simply speak the command from the sofa: ‘Alexa, boil the kettle.’

It may seem like a small thing, but when you need a cuppa, you need one, and it doesn’t get much easier than this.
